Product description :

Benefits:

  • Environmentally safe:Contains no phosphates, borates or nitrates.
  • Economical:One bottle of NSP Concentrate makes the equivalent of over 8,300 bottles of the leading window cleaner when using 4 drops of concentrate per one litre of water.
  • Can be used to wash the dishes, clean appliances, windows, walls, floors, fine china, pots and pans, silverware, copper, and brass.
  • Use fully concentrated to remove grease/oil form tools, driveways, and around the garage.

How It Works:

NSP Concentrate is a general purpose, non-flammable cleaning concentrate that is effective on all types of dirt and grime, yet won’t harm the environment or the ones you love, because it contains no polluting phosphates, borates or nitrates. Its biodegradable cleaning and sudsing agents break down easily, helping to prevent foaming or sudsing problems in our lakes and streams.

Ingredients:

Water, linear alcohol alkoxylate (biodegradable cleaning agent), diazolidinyl urea, fragrance, methylparaben, propylparaben, tetrasodium EDTA.

Recommended Use:

Use as directed for all household cleaning jobs and personal hygiene.
